Statistical Decline in Key Offensive Metrics

Jalen Brunson's injury has resulted in a significant downturn in several key offensive metrics for the New York Knicks. His absence has exposed the team's reliance on his playmaking and scoring abilities. Let's examine the numbers:

  • Points Per Game: Before Brunson's injury, the Knicks averaged around 110 points per game. Since his absence, that average has dropped to approximately 98 points per game, a concerning 12-point decrease. This significant drop highlights his crucial role in generating scoring opportunities.

  • Field Goal Percentage & Three-Point Percentage: The Knicks' overall shooting efficiency has suffered. Their field goal percentage has dipped from around 46% to closer to 42%, and their three-point percentage has fallen from 35% to approximately 32%. This indicates a struggle to convert even high-quality scoring chances.

  • Assists: Brunson's absence has drastically impacted the Knicks' assist numbers. Prior to his injury, the team averaged around 24 assists per game; this figure has now fallen to roughly 18 assists per game, reflecting a breakdown in ball movement and playmaking.

  • Offensive Rating: This crucial statistic, which measures points scored per 100 possessions, has plummeted since Brunson's injury. The Knicks' offensive rating has dropped from a respectable 112 to around 105, showcasing a significant decrease in overall offensive efficiency.

  • Individual Player Impact: The decline isn't solely a team-wide issue; individual players are also struggling. Players who thrived off Brunson's playmaking are seeing fewer scoring opportunities, leading to decreased personal performance and a domino effect on the entire team's scoring capabilities.

The Impact on Playmaking and Ball Movement

Jalen Brunson's impact extends far beyond simple scoring; his playmaking and ability to orchestrate the offense are invaluable to the Knicks. His absence has created a noticeable void.

  • Reduced Scoring Opportunities: Brunson's exceptional court vision and ability to penetrate defenses created numerous high-percentage scoring opportunities for his teammates. Without him, the Knicks are struggling to generate those same opportunities.

  • Isolation Plays: The Knicks have become increasingly reliant on isolation plays, with players attempting to create their own shots rather than benefiting from efficient ball movement. This predictable offensive approach is easily defended.

Exploring Solutions and Adjustments

The Knicks need to implement strategic changes to compensate for Brunson's absence. This includes several key adjustments:

  • Offensive System Adjustments: The coaching staff needs to re-evaluate the team's offensive strategy, perhaps incorporating more pick-and-roll plays designed to exploit individual matchups, rather than relying solely on Brunson's playmaking ability.

  • Increased Responsibilities: The increased minutes and scoring responsibility given to other players need to be managed effectively. Players need to be comfortable with this elevated role to contribute positively.

  • Coaching Strategies: The coaching staff's ability to make in-game adjustments and motivate the players is crucial during this challenging period. New strategies must be implemented, and adapted as the season progresses.

  • Lineup Changes: Experimenting with different lineup combinations could help unlock offensive potential by maximizing player matchups and strengths. This might involve utilizing more spacing or adjusting defensive assignments to ease the offensive burden on individual players.
